D&E Tree and Property Management

D&E Tree and Property Management has an array of skilled climbers and professionals to remove a tree in any type of tight situation in the Columbus, GA area. Whether a tree is close to a power line, leaning on a home or next to a fence our team is able to remove it without causing any type of damage.
